DIY Leather Sofa Stain Removal: Tea Stains

One of the first things you can try when dealing with a tea stain on your leather sofa is a DIY solution. Mix a few drops of mild dish soap with warm water and dip a clean cloth into the solution. Gently dab the tea stain with the cloth, being careful not to rub too hard as this can damage the leather. Once the stain is lifted, wipe the area with a clean, damp cloth to remove any soap residue.

Keep Your Leather Sofa Looking Like New

tea stain on leather sofa Leather sofas are a classic and luxurious addition to any home, but they require special care to maintain their beauty and longevity. Unfortunately, accidents happen and a tea stain on your leather sofa can be a frustrating and unsightly problem. However, with the right techniques, you can easily remove the stain and keep your leather sofa looking like new. In this article, we will provide you with expert tips on how to effectively remove tea stains from your leather sofa. Prevention is Key As the saying goes, prevention is better than cure. To avoid tea stains on your leather sofa, it's important to take preventative measures. Place coasters or trays on your coffee table to prevent tea cups from leaving rings and spills on your sofa. If you do end up with a tea stain, act quickly and follow these steps to effectively remove it. Supplies You Will Need Before you begin the stain removal process, it's important to gather all the necessary supplies. You will need a soft cloth, distilled water, mild soap, and a leather cleaner. Be sure to test any cleaning solutions on a small, inconspicuous area of your sofa first to ensure it does not cause any damage. Step-by-Step Guide 1. Blot the Stain: As soon as the tea is spilled, use a clean, dry cloth to gently blot the stain. Do not rub, as this can spread the stain and cause it to set into the leather. 2. Prepare a Cleaning Solution: In a small bowl, mix one teaspoon of mild soap with one cup of distilled water. Stir the solution until it becomes sudsy. 3. Clean the Stain: Dip a clean, soft cloth into the cleaning solution and wring out any excess liquid. Gently blot the stain, working from the outside in to avoid spreading it. Continue blotting until the stain is removed. 4. Rinse with Distilled Water: Once the stain is removed, rinse the area with a clean cloth dipped in distilled water. This will help remove any leftover soap residue. 5. Dry the Area: Use a dry cloth to absorb any excess moisture and then allow the area to air dry completely. 6. Use a Leather Cleaner: If the stain persists, you may need to use a leather cleaner specifically designed for your type of leather. Follow the instructions on the product and be sure to test it on a small area first. Final Thoughts Tea stains may seem like a daunting problem on your leather sofa, but with the right techniques, you can easily remove them and keep your furniture looking like new. Remember to act quickly, use gentle cleaning solutions, and always test on a small area first. With these tips, you can enjoy your beautiful leather sofa for years to come.
